SQL Genie Columns Tab

Description

The Columns tab of the SQL Genie defines the fields that your SQL SELECT statement will return. To select a field for your report.

Any time that the Execute Query button, the 'lightning' icon is enabled, you may click it to see a sample of the records that the query will return. At any time you may click the History button to see a list of SQL statements previously created in this session in the SQL History Dialog.

Adding Columns to the Report

  1. Make a table selection from the drop down list box at the top left corner of the screen.

    • Optionally, select "* (all columns)" in the Available Columns list and click '>' to add them to the report.

    • Optionally, select one or more columns from the Available Columns list and click '>' to add them to the report.

    • Optionally, click '>>' to add all columns from the currently selected table to the report.

    • To remove a column from the report, select it in the Selected Columns list and click '<'.

    • To remove all columns from the report, click '<<'.

  2. Repeat with any other table that you selected on the Tables tab.

  3. Optionally, click Insert Expression to display the SQL Expression dialog to select a column or write an expression to add to the Selected Columns list.

  4. The vertical order of columns in the Selected Columns list is their order from left to right on the report. To change the position of a column in the Selected Columns list:

    • Select it and click the following to move it to the left-most position on the report.

  5. You may change properties of each column in the Selected Columns list.

  • Column

    The name of a field or an expression that combines 2 or more columns. Click to display the SQL Expression dialog to select a column or write an expression.

  • Alias

    Creates an alias for the column, which is expressed as an "AS Alias " clause.

  • Table

    The table that contains the column.

  • Show

    When selected (TRUE), the column will display on the report.

  • Data type

    The data type of the selected column.

  • Sort

    Defines whether to sort the report on this column in ascending or descending order. Your choices here will appear on the Order tab of the SQL Genie and in the ORDER BY clause of the SQL SELECT statement.
